Currently, Kazakhstan operates a 7.5-megawatt (MW) pilot energy storage system at a substation in Kokshetau. The facility is being used to test how storage systems interact with the grid.

In April, Kazakhstan held its first auctions for large wind power projects, including storage systems. State support remains a key driver of growth in the sector.
